How to add QMetry Custom Dashboard Embedded URL in Confluence?

The user who has created a custom dashboard can generate an embedded URL and share the link. The embedded URL gives access over live report data in read-only mode to the users who do not have direct access to QMetry application (i.e. Ability to view custom dashboard without any authentication). This link can be used to share the dashboard with other users or for integration with third-party integrations.

Steps to share Dashboard through Embedded URL

  1. Go to the QMetry Custom Dashboard > My Dashboard > select the dashboard that you would like to share

  2. Click on the Share Dashboard icon, the screen opens with two tabs on it: Users and Embedded URL.

  3. Open the Embedded URL tab

  4. Click Generate to generate the embedded URL.


    It is to be noted that the URL remains valid and active unless it is regenerated or deleted.

Steps to use Embedded URL in Confluence

You can use the Embedded URL in Confluence to view the QMetry dashboard reports on the Confluence page. This way, users who do not have access over QMetry can view QMetry reports directly in Confluence. These reports will be displayed in read-only mode. 

Pre-requisites:

  • QMetry Application and Confluence both should be configured on https.

  • There should be connectivity between QMetry and Confluence.

Steps:

  1. In Confluence, create a blank page by clicking on the Create button.

  2. Open the “+” drop-down menu and select View more to search for more macros.

  3. Insert the iframe macro in the Confluence page. Refer to this article for more details.

  4. Type “iframe” in the search box to search for the iframe macro.

  5. Add the following settings for the Iframe window -

    • Enter the QMetry Custom Dashboard Embedded URL in URL.

    • Width of iframe (recommended: 1000)

    • Height of iframe (recommended: 3000)

    • Scrolling: Auto

  6. You can Preview the page in the window.

  7. Now Publish the confluence page.

  8. You can see the iframe is added to the page. QMetry report is rendered on the page in read-only mode.
